Chemical & Physical Properties
| Density | 1.2±0.1 g/cm3 |
|---|---|
| Boiling Point | 436.7±12.0 °C at 760 mmHg |
| Melting Point | 158-160℃ |
| Molecular Formula | C18H12 |
| Molecular Weight | 228.288 |
| Flash Point | 209.1±13.7 °C |
| Exact Mass | 228.093903 |
| LogP | 5.91 |
| Vapour Pressure | 0.0±0.5 mmHg at 25°C |
| Index of Refraction | 1.771 |
| InChIKey | TUAHORSUHVUKBD-UHFFFAOYSA-N |
| SMILES | c1ccc2c(c1)ccc1ccc3ccccc3c12 |
